Iran War Makes Diet Coke Costlier in India

Shorts Updated: July 26, 2026 12:43 IST

The ongoing Iran conflict has pushed up Diet Coke prices in India by over 10%, disrupting aluminum can supplies. Coca-Cola has introduced larger 330 ml cans priced at ₹50, replacing the popular 300 ml variant, as supply chain disruptions continue to impact the market.

Qualcomm Price Hike May Make Android Phones Costlier

Shorts Updated: July 25, 2026 16:07 IST

Buying a new Android phone could soon become more expensive. Qualcomm has reportedly informed customers that it will raise chip prices by a double digit percentage for shipments after September 1, citing rising supplier costs and ongoing component shortages. The increase could push up prices of smartphones and AI powered Windows laptops.

Fresh Plea in Supreme Court Seeks NEET CBT Roadmap

Shorts Updated: July 24, 2026 09:21 IST

Ahead of today's Supreme Court hearing on the NEET UG paper leak case, petitioners filed an additional plea seeking a detailed Standard Operating Procedure for the proposed Computer Based Test format. They argued that merely shifting from pen and paper to CBT would not be enough to prevent future irregularities.
